Subject: ProfileVault sharding cutover — complete

Team, the ProfileVault user-profile store is now split across eight shards keyed by account hash. Future maintainers: rebalancing scripts live in the ops repo, and the shard map is versioned — never edit it by hand. Dual-write mode stays on for two weeks. The cutover's build token follows below.

build token for tahop-fafof: htk14_2d55df8101eccc

CI note: the Gatecount turnstile counter's integration tests fail intermittently on the shared runner. Cause is a clock-skew assumption — entry events timestamped by the simulated turnstile drift ahead of the test harness, so totals mismatch by one or two. Not a tampering signal; counts reconcile once clocks are pinned. Security impact assessed as none. Failing runs all share the token shown below.

build token for kagaf-hahof: htk14_9d3d4d26d7d8de

Q3 Planning Note — Board of Veltrona Industries

Quick update: our single-source arrangement for the Karrow valve housings keeps us exposed, so procurement has kicked off a second-source search. Three candidates in the Delmest region look promising; site visits happen next month. Costs should stay flat. Marta will brief you on the shortlist at the October session.

board note of fafog-yahap: Project Rusdor slips by a full year because of the audit delay.

## Releases

Each Lintgarde release regenerates the static-analysis baseline file and signs it before publication. Reviewers should confirm the baseline diff contains only intentional suppressions and that the signature validates against the release manifest. Builds with an unsigned or stale baseline must be rejected. Verification requires the current release signing key, shown below:

rollout seal: bky4_yke3

**Ticket: Lintbase vault locked again**

Hey folks — welcome aboard! Quick heads-up: the Quillmark static-analysis baseline file lives in the Copperbolt vault, and the vault auto-locked after three failed unlock attempts last night. Until it's open, you can't regenerate the baseline or suppress legacy warnings, so new PRs will look noisier than they are. To unlock it, open the Copperbolt client, pick the Quillmark space, and enter the phrase below.

strongbox words: norwyn-wenael-aldvan-aldiel-wendor-holael